EasyVista Posts Strong FY’2016 Earnings Growth with Robust SaaS Sales; Investor Confidence Propels Aggressive Innovation and Market Expansion

Strong customer growth, SaaS adoption, product innovation, and investment funding punctuate the second half of 2016

NEW YORK, NY – March 1, 2017 — EasyVista Inc., a leading provider of service management for IT organizations, today announced that its 14% increase in revenue growth in 2016 was driven by vigorous SaaS sales, continued product innovation and deeper penetration in strategic vertical markets. This acceleration was fueled in part by the company’s $8.4M private placement, which was earmarked for continued expansion in North America, especially for EasyVista’s SaaS-based IT service management solutions.

Financial Highlights

  • FY’2016 Total Revenue Growth: 14% increase over FY’2015
  • FY’2016 SaaS Global Revenue: 24% increase over FY’2015
  • FY’2016 SaaS North America Revenue: 38% increase over FY’2015
  • FY’2016 Licenses Revenue: 20% increase over FY’2015

New Customers and Engagement in H2’2016

  • Strategic verticals: The company saw growth in strategic vertical markets, including higher education, healthcare and financial services.
  • Key customer wins in North America: American Red Cross; Clark County, Washington; Corizon Health; Dixon Hughes Goodman; Dunne Manning; Golden Valley Health Centers; Kellogg School of Management; Oregon Public Utility Commission; Penn National Gaming; and Quantum Health.
  • Key customer wins in Europe:
    • France: Académie de Bordeaux; Autodistribution; Conseil Départemental Loire Atlantique; Digital Dimension; EDF Energies Nouvelles; Grant Thornton; Ordre des Avocats; Mairie de Versailles; Sopra RH; and Yvelines Le Dé
    • Southern Europe: Automóvel Club de Portugal; Banco BIG; BNP Paribas Cardif; Centro Hospitalar Tondela Viseu; Galletas Gullón; Rede Eléctrica Nacional; and SPMS.
  • Customer adoption of mobile apps: There was a 17% increase in the number of end users requesting service via EasyVista’s innovative service apps.
  • Customer community growth: EasyVista’s EV Connect online customer community crossed the 500-member mark and its EV Connect annual user conference doubled its attendance over 2015.

Product Innovation

  • Service Apps: Product enhancements were made to help companies detect and resolve the root cause of service issues and accelerate the creation of service apps.
  • Integrations: New connectors were introduced for IT operations and development solutions such as Splunk, Trello, FreshDesk and BugZilla. The company also introduced rest-based integration builders so companies can create custom integrations to other applications.

Industry Recognition

  • Gartner Magic Quadrant: EasyVista was again recognized on the Gartner Magic Quadrant for IT Service Support and Management Tools, one of only 10 companies to be included from among the 450+ ITSM companies in the market.
  • Gartner Peer Insights: EasyVista received an average score of 4.7 (out of 5 possible) by IT end user customers on Gartner Peer Insights.
  • Security Audit: EasyVista became one of very few to earn the coveted independent audit (SSAE-16 Type 2), underscoring its commitment to safe, secure ITSM in the cloud.
  • “2016 HOT in New York”: EasyVista won Owler’s “2016 HOT in New York” award, an honor received by only 4,500 companies out of 15 million total company profiles.

Leadership

  • Corporate Expansion: Vincent Migayrou joined as CFO to support continued global growth. A seasoned executive, Migayrou brings deep knowledge of growing global technology companies with SaaS and on-premise business models.
  • Regional Sales Expansion: Gary Mellot joined as Vice President of Sales—Western Region, to drive aggressive growth in North America. Mellot brings extensive experience in the ITSM market and in business strategy and channel development.

“We’re excited to see yet another six-month period where customer demand is driving our success in providing leading mobile apps and SaaS solutions,” said Sylvain Gauthier, EasyVista co-founder and CEO. “We are gratified by our customers’ high ratings for our product and confidence in our vision, as well as our new investors whose backing will drive extensive innovation in the months ahead.”
